Princes Roll Over Black Squirrels, 13-3
|
The Bel Air Princes knocked off the Tree City Black Squirrels, 13-3, at The Nut House. Mike Flowers was named player of the game for Bel Air. He hit 1 single and 2 doubles, while driving in 3 runs. Bel Air reliever Naotake Nakamura picked up the win, upping his record to 2-1. Tsuginori Oda shouldered the loss. Bel Air is now riding a 3-game win streak.
Josh Cobleigh, who is tied for 7th in the DML in RBI with 80, aided the Bel Air cause with a run-scoring walk in the top of the second. For the game, the shortstop was 1 for 4 with a double and 2 walks. He scored 2 times.
Flowers said afterward that his team has grown over the course of the season, adding: "It feels good when a plan comes together."
